04
Cover of Toshakhana: A Multidimensional Panjabi Corpus in Gurmukhi Script
Conference Paper

Toshakhana: A Multidimensional Panjabi Corpus in Gurmukhi Script

ACM Southeast ConferenceApril 2024

With Thai Le, Yixin Chen

A temporal Panjabi text corpus in Gurmukhi script created for natural-language processing research.

05
Cover of Building an Open-Source Nanakshahi Calendar
Peer-Reviewed Journal Article

Building an Open-Source Nanakshahi Calendar: Identity and a Spiritual and Computational Journey

Sikh Research Journal · Vol. 5 No. 2October 2020

With Amandeep Singh, Amanpreet Singh, Harvinder Singh, Parm Singh

Examines the original Nanakshahi calendar and documents an open-source programming library designed for adoption in software.
